openSUSEa suomeksi
openSUSE => Turvallisuus ja laitteisto => Aiheen aloitti: jboman - 05.05.2009 - klo:09:20
-
Moi,
Mulla on tuommoinen SCR3310 USB Smart Card Reader lukija.
Ongelma on että ei toimi opensuse 11.1 / firefox yhdistelmällä.
Samassa koneessa on opensuse 10.2 ja homma toimii ok.
Olen mielestäni asentanut kaikki tarpeelliset ja tehnyt firefoxilla liitoksen /usr/lib/opensc-pkcs11.so tiedostoon.
Näyttää pelkästään:
OpenCT
OpenCT
OpenCT
OpenCT
OpenCT
OpenCT
OpenCT
OpenCT
OpenCT
OpenCT
Kun tuolla 10.2 puolella
HENKILOKORTTI
HENKILOKORTTI
OpenCT
OpenCT
OpenCT
OpenCT
OpenCT
OpenCT
Jolloin tuonne henkilökortille pääsee kirjautumaan ok.
Yritin myös asentaan mPollux Digisign Client ohjelman, mutta sen tarvitsemat kirjastot ovat vanhoja enkä saanut sitä toimimaan.
--- slip ----
mPollux Digisign Client -kortinlukijaohjelmisto on ladattavissa http://www.fineid.fi -sivustolta.
Windows-versioiden julkaisun jälkeen Väestörekisterikeskus julkaisee vuoden 2008 aikana mPollux Digisign Client -kortinlukijaohjelmistosta versiot Linuxille (openSUSE 10.3, Redhat Enterprise Linux 5 ja Ubuntu 7.10) ja MAC OS X -käyttöjärjestelmille (10.4, 10.5).
--- slip ----
Onko joku saanut vastaavan pelaamaan opensuse 11.1:ssä ?
-
Asiaan liittyen:
Ei toimi vieläkään firefoxilla, mutta muuten kaikki opensc-tool yms. työkalut tunnistaa lukijan että kortin.
Joten olen yrittänyt asentaa mpollux ohjelmaa.
Tein linkin libdbus-1.so.2, mutta herjaa edelleen....
# ls -ltr /lib/libdb*
-rwxr-xr-x 1 root root 264352 2.4. 19:29 /lib/libdbus-1.so.3.4.0
lrwxrwxrwx 1 root root 18 17.4. 22:03 /lib/libdbus-1.so.3 -> libdbus-1.so.3.4.0
lrwxrwxrwx 1 root root 18 6.5. 17:50 /lib/libdbus-1.so.2 -> libdbus-1.so.3.4.0
# rpm -ivh mpollux-digisign-client-1.0.1-1511.i586.rpm
virhe: Puuttuvia riippuvuuksia:
libdbus-1.so.2 is needed by mpollux-digisign-client-1.0.1-1511.i586
???
-
Tein linkin libdbus-1.so.2, mutta herjaa edelleen....
# ls -ltr /lib/libdb*
-rwxr-xr-x 1 root root 264352 2.4. 19:29 /lib/libdbus-1.so.3.4.0
lrwxrwxrwx 1 root root 18 17.4. 22:03 /lib/libdbus-1.so.3 -> libdbus-1.so.3.4.0
lrwxrwxrwx 1 root root 18 6.5. 17:50 /lib/libdbus-1.so.2 -> libdbus-1.so.3.4.0
# rpm -ivh mpollux-digisign-client-1.0.1-1511.i586.rpm
virhe: Puuttuvia riippuvuuksia:
libdbus-1.so.2 is needed by mpollux-digisign-client-1.0.1-1511.i586
Tuon symbolisen linkin tekeminen ei taida auttaa, paketti pitäisi päivittää. Tuo SLED10 jolle paketti on tehty, on kuitenkin jo aika vanha.
-
No joo, niin mä vähän arvelinkin.
No pitänee yrittää vielä uudelleen tuota "normaali" tapaa firefoxilla.
-
Huomasin, että Redhat Enterprise Linux 5 versio toimii opensuse 11.1
Palvelun joutuu käynnistämään käsin:
mpollux_digisign_certloader
ja firefoxissa pitää ladata toi:
/usr/lib/libcryptoki.so
jotta homma pelaa.
Nyt pelittää toi henkilökortin lukija moitteetta.